The transformation of cross-border cooperation in today's economic landscape

The contemporary economic sphere operates within a complex web of global criteria and collaborative contracts. Regulatory bodies across different jurisdictions work together to ensure comprehensive oversight of global financial activities. This joint method has become essential for maintaining system integrity.

International governance frameworks serve as the backbone of modern financial governance, developing extensive requirements that guide nations in their oversight responsibilities. These structures include a variety of assessment methodologies and conformance systems designed to guarantee robust financial system integrity. Assessment methodologies used by global governance entities include stringent assessment standards that examine multiple aspects of governance efficiency. These approaches are crafted to offer thorough evaluations of how well jurisdictions implement international standards. The assessment procedure typically involves detailed document reviews, and extensive consultations with appropriate parties. Peer evaluation tools are utilised often to guarantee neutrality and uniformity in evaluation results. Follow-up procedures are established to track development in resolving recognised shortcomings and to provide ongoing support. Cross-border cooperation mechanisms have become sophisticated, facilitating efficient information exchange and collaborated actions to oversight issues. These structures enable regulatory authorities from different jurisdictions to collaborate effortlessly, sharing knowledge and resources to address mutual issues. The establishment of formal cooperation agreements has bolstered the ability of nations to respond collectively to emerging threats and maintain system stability. Routine discussions among governing entities helps ensure uniform enforcement of global criteria and promotes mutual . understanding of different regulatory approaches. Technical assistance programmes play a vital function in supporting jurisdictions that require additional resources or proficiency to fulfill global criteria. These initiatives typically involve the offer of courses, capacity building campaigns, and continuous guidance to help enhance local oversight abilities.
